Barry John McCarthy (born 13 September 1992, in Dublin) is an Irish cricketer who plays for Durham and made his first-class debut in 2015. Primarily a right-arm medium pace bowler, he also bats right handed. McCarthy has represented Ireland U19s in five matches. His sister, Louise McCarthy is an international cricketer for Ireland Women. He made his Twenty20 debut on 20 May 2016 for Durham against Worcestershire Rapids in the 2016 NatWest t20 Blast.

In June 2016 he was named in Ireland's squad for their One Day International (ODI) series against Sri Lanka. He made his ODI debut for Ireland on 16 June 2016. He made his Twenty20 International (T20I) debut for Ireland against Afghanistan on 10 March 2017 and took 4 wickets. But unfortunately for him, his performance in only his 2nd T20I with bowling figures were the most expensive bowling figures in a T20I.
